admin管理员组文章数量:1533882
2024年3月27日发(作者:)
基于mysql的学生成绩管理系统毕业设计
题目:基于MySQL的学生成绩管理系统毕业设计
在现代信息技术飞速发展的时代,数据库管理系统已经成为了各行各
业不可或缺的一部分。特别是在教育领域,学生成绩管理系统的建设
对于学校和教师来说至关重要。在这篇文章中,我将围绕着基于
MySQL的学生成绩管理系统毕业设计展开一番讨论。
一、引言
MySQL作为世界上最流行的开源关系数据库管理系统,其稳定性和高
效性备受赞誉。结合学生成绩管理系统的需求,借助MySQL数据库
的特性,可以实现学生成绩的高效管理和统计分析。接下来,我将从
数据库设计、系统功能和使用体验三个方面,对基于MySQL的学生
成绩管理系统毕业设计进行详细探讨。
二、数据库设计
1. 数据库表结构设计
在设计学生成绩管理系统数据库时,需要考虑如何构建合理的表结构,
以便存储学生信息、课程信息和成绩信息等。对于学生成绩管理系统
而言,一般情况下包括学生表、课程表、成绩表等几个核心表。其中,
学生表包括学生ID、尊称、性别等字段;课程表包括课程ID、课程名
称、学分等字段;成绩表包括学生ID、课程ID、成绩等字段。通过合
理的表结构设计,可以实现数据的高效存储和查询。
2. 索引和约束设计
在数据库设计中,索引和约束的设计也是至关重要的。通过对关键字
段添加索引,可以提高数据的检索速度;利用约束来保证数据的完整
性和一致性。可以通过主键约束来保证学生ID和课程ID的唯一性;
通过外键约束来建立表与表之间的关联关系。这些都是数据库设计中
不可或缺的一部分。
三、系统功能
基于MySQL的学生成绩管理系统,其功能应该覆盖学生信息管理、
课程信息管理、成绩录入和成绩查询等方面。通过一个直观的用户界
面,教师可以方便地录入学生成绩,并进行统计分析;学生和家长也
可以通过系统进行成绩查询和学习进度跟踪。在毕业设计中,需要考
虑系统的易用性、稳定性和安全性,以确保其能够满足实际应用的需
求。
四、使用体验
版权声明:本文标题:基于mysql的学生成绩管理系统毕业设计 内容由热心网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:https://m.elefans.com/xitong/1711514027a313560.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论